3 3/4" 2 piece snap together plastic ornament. Cut a paper circle the diameter of the inside and once it is decorated, rest it ito the half with the lip edge inside. Add snow or glitter or confetti beforehand and snap together. Add ribbon on the outside to cover where the two halves snap together and add a ribbon bow at the top and a hanging loop. I used one of my drinking glasses for a circle pattern, so that measeurement is exactly 3 13/16 if you can do it with a compass.  I originally made these in 1992 using a DOTS hearth/stocking/wreath set and added 5 stockings with the family names to the hearth. DGD is working on one right now for their tree and I will post a pic when she is done. You could also use photos. They are fun and easy to do...Finding the correct circle size is the hardest part.
